Draw the image of the shape g under the translation that sends the point P to the point S.

99%

104 rated

Answer

To draw the shape gg under the translation that sends point PP to point SS, we first determine the translation vector. The coordinates of points PP and SS need to be identified. If point PP is at (x1,y1)(x_1, y_1) and point SS is at (x2,y2)(x_2, y_2):

  • The translation vector can be calculated as:

extTranslationVector=(x2x1,y2y1) ext{Translation Vector} = (x_2 - x_1, y_2 - y_1)

This vector is then applied to each vertex of shape gg to find their new positions. After applying the translation, the shape should be redrawn accordingly, ensuring that all corresponding vertices of the original shape retain their relative positions.
